Timothee Chalamet's Oscar Odds Plummet After Dismissing Opera and Ballet as Irrelevant

Timothee Chalamet, once a frontrunner for Best Actor for his role in 'Marty Supreme,' has seen his Oscar chances collapse following controversial remarks calling opera and ballet art forms 'no one cares about anymore.' Steven Spielberg publicly defended the arts, criticizing Chalamet's snub amid the final stretch of awards campaigning. The backlash highlights tensions in Hollywood as the 98th Academy Awards approach on March 15 in Los Angeles. Industry insiders note this could shift voter sentiment toward other contenders.
